WebPlace turkey breast side up on a sheet pan. Liberally rub butter-herb mixture completely over the entire turkey. Refrigerate 24 to 48 hours uncovered. Remove turkey from the fridge and bring to room temperature while your grill or smoker is reaching 225 degrees. Oil the rungs of the rack to keep the bird from sticking. Your turkey must pass through a critical range of 40° F to 140° F in 4 hours or less. If the internal temperature is low after … suv with 500 hpWebAug 16, 2024 · When smoking a turkey between 225° - 250°, the rule of thumb is to cook it for about 30 minutes per pound. This is for an unstuffed bird that has been brined on a smoker where the temperature is holding steady.
